Emmanuel Frimpong will love to join a Championship side for more game time

Ghanaian starlet Emmanuel Frimpong has admitted he will consider a move to Championship sides Cardiff City or Charlton Athletic.

The powerful midfielder fell off the pecking order on his return from a cruciate knee ligament injury that kept him out of action for eight months last season.

The 19-year-old, who has not hidden his desire to play for the Black Stars, is unsure about first team play next season at the Emirates.

He says he will consider a move to Cardiff or Charlton Athletic who have made approaches to get regular play.

Frimpong said: “It was a difficult season for me with the injury and the comeback but I think I will need to look elsewhere if the current situation continues.”

“Cardiff and Charlton have made enquiries and my understanding is that they’re very serious about me. If I’m not going to get regular play at Arsenal, then what is the point in staying there? He asked

“I definitely move on and my career with Arsenal will be over.”
